Trenitalia Intercity is a high-speed train service operated by the Italian national railway company, Trenitalia. It operates throughout the country, with services running from early morning to late evening. The Intercity trains come in two types: the Intercity Plus, which is the fastest and most comfortable, and the Intercity, which is slightly slower but still offers a comfortable journey. Onboard facilities include air conditioning, power sockets, Wi-Fi, and a bar service. There are several ticket types available, including Standard, Super Economy, and Business. The most popular routes for Trenitalia Intercity are from Rome to Milan, Naples to Florence, and Turin to Venice.
FlixBus is one of the most popular low-cost travel companies in Europe. Founded in Germany, FlixBus has expanded its services throughout Europe and even to the United States, giving travelers in both continents the option to take a long-distance travel at an affordable price. FlixBus also operates overnight travel on select routes throughout Europe. FlixBus offers only the Standard ticket for all its routes, which allows you to bring one carry-on bag and one checked bag per person. Additional fees apply for bringing extra luggage and making specific seat reservations, such as if you want to book an Extra Seat, Table Seat or the Panorama Seat. Standard amenities onboard include free Wi-Fi, power outlets to charge your phone, tablet or laptop during long travel journeys, extra legroom, luggage space and toilets.
There are 2 ways to get from Milan to Ravenna: bus or train.
The cheapest way to get from Milan to Ravenna is by taking a train with average ticket prices of $29 (€25) compared to other travel options to Ravenna:
A train is $35 (€30) less than a bus with an average ticket price of $64 (€55) from Milan to Ravenna.
The quickest way to travel between Milan and Ravenna is by train, which takes on average 4 h 26 min compared to other travel options that take longer:
Bus takes on average 5 h 55 min.
You should expect to travel around 164 miles (264 km) between Milan and Ravenna.
